Choosing the Perfect Grain-Free Dog Food

Providing your canine companion with a nourishing and balanced diet is paramount to their overall well-being. Many pet parents are choosing grain-free dog food options, believing they offer enhanced digestibility and nutritional benefits. However, with so many formulas available, finding the best grain-free dog food can feel overwhelming. A high-quality grain-free diet should be packed with animal sources, healthy fats, and essential vitamins and minerals to promote your dog's energy levels.

When selecting a grain-free dog food, consider the formula. Opt for foods that contain real meat as the first ingredient and limit fillers, artificial colors, flavors, and preservatives.

It's also crucial to select a food that satisfies your dog's specific age. Puppies, adults, and seniors all have different nutritional demands. Consulting with your veterinarian can help you determine the best grain-free dog food for your furry friend's individual needs.

Navigating Dog Food Ingredients: A Guide to Healthy Choices

Choosing the right dog food can feel like navigating a labyrinth of confusing ingredients. Identifying what goes into your pup's bowl is crucial for their health and well-being. Don't worry, we're here to uncover the truth the mystery!

Start by scrutinizing the ingredient list. Quality protein should be listed first, followed by nutritious carbohydrates. Avoid ingredients you can't pronounce. Artificial colors, flavors, and preservatives offer no nutritional value and may affect your dog's health.

Remember, a balanced diet is key to a thriving canine companion! Consult with your veterinarian for personalized recommendations based on your dog's age, breed, and activity level. They can help you select a nutritious diet to keep your furry friend vibrant.

Understanding Dog Food Labels: What to Look For

Navigating the jungle of dog food labels can be tricky. But with a little knowledge, you can decode what's really in your furry friend's food. First, scrutinize the components. Look for wholeoptions like protein as the first entry, and steer clear of processed additives. Next, check the analysis panel for balancedratios of {protein, fat, and carbohydrates. A good diet should also containinclude key supplements. Remember, every dog is unique, so consulting with your veterinarian can help you choose the best food for your furry friend.
